Routing table change is fine. Plugin authors: Linkfern resolves deep links in priority order, and your handler's timeout budget comes out of the shared pool — don't assume defaults. Register schemes before init or you'll be skipped. Retries are capped globally. The limits you must stay within are these.

limits module of tafop-hahop:
WEIGHTS = {
    "julmir": 223,
    "belox": 987,
    "lamion": 470,
    "pelath": 609,
    "fraok": 1010,
    "eliion": 343,
    "drudor": 342,
}

## 4.2.0 — Offline mode defaults changed

FieldTrace's offline mode is now enabled by default for all survey crews. Previously, surveyors opted in per device; audit findings showed inconsistent adoption led to data loss in low-coverage zones. Cached responses are now encrypted at rest on the device, and the sync window shortened from 72 to 24 hours. Stale caches are purged automatically after a failed sync deadline. For review purposes, the shipped defaults are listed below.

config for kajog-tadug:
[casax]
port = 11211
region = west-3
host = casax.nelvroworks.internal
timeout_ms = 5000
retries = 7

LinkVane deep-link routing for the spring release. Resolver QPS doubles during push-notification bursts; the route cache absorbs most of it, but cold-start after a deploy is the risk window. We sized the cache and warmup concurrency off last quarter's peak plus 40% headroom. Before sign-off, confirm staging runs with the planned production constants, listed below.

constants for bawif-kawif:
QUOTAS = {
    "ulaael": 5,
    "holael": 10,
}

MEMO — Kettling Depot Receiving

Uniform sets for the new Kettling depot arrive Wednesday via Ashgrove courier: 40 boxes, sorted by size, manifest attached to box one. Check the count at the dock before signing; shortages go straight to stores, not the courier. The hand-over instruction the courier will follow is set out below.

drop instructions, tafof-baguf: the holmir gilox courier leaves the sormir ulaok holdor ledger at gate 5596 under passcode 257343